Laravel Livewire y TDD: Crea un Portafolio Dinámico

Construye un Portafolio Dinámico aplicando TDD con Laravel, Livewire, TailwindCSS y Alpine.js

4.85 (12 reviews)
Udemy
platform
Español
language
Web Development
category
instructor
Laravel Livewire y TDD: Crea un Portafolio Dinámico
138
students
17.5 hours
content
Jun 2023
last update
$54.99
regular price

What you will learn

Livewire: Componentes, propiedades, métodos, eventos, hooks, validación y traits

Subida y descarga de archivos con Livewire

Integración con TailwindCSS y AlpineJs

Aplicar Desarrollo Basado en Pruebas (TDD) a los componentes de Livewire

Construir un portafolio dinámico con Laravel Livewire

Why take this course?

Con éste talller de Livewire, vas a poder asentar aún más los conocimientos básicos que tengas de ésta herramienta, además, profundizarás en los mismos y aprenderás nuevas funcionalidades que no se utilizaron en el curso básico.


En este taller construiremos un portafolio dinámico aplicando TDD o Test Driven Development (Desarrollo basado en pruebas). Donde lo primero que haremos es escribir algunas pruebas y luego codificaremos lo necesario para que las mismas funcionen. No te preocupes si no tienes conocimientos sobre TDD, yo te explicaré en detalle cada prueba para que  lo puedas entender. La idea de esto, es que puedas empezar a aplicar ésta metodología en tus propios proyectos con Livewire.


El portafolio que construiremos tendrá 3 secciones (Inicio, Proyectos y Contacto), las cuales tendrán uno o más componentes de Livewire y dentro de los mismos usaremos propiedades, acciones o métodos, hooks, eventos, traits entre otras cosas.


Cabe resaltar que usaremos TailwindCSS para la interfáz, la cual estará pre-fabricada, es decir, no tendremos que hacerla desde cero, ya que la idea de este curso es enfocarnos en los componentes de Livewire. Te daré acceso a todo lo necesario antes de comenzar el taller para que durante el desarrollo del mismo no tengas que preocuparte sobre el HTML y el CSS.


Igualmente pasará con Alpine.js, el cuál es un framework de JavaScript bastante ligero, y lo utilizaremos en menor medida para hacer cosas muy específicas. Aquí obviamente te explicaré cada detalle para que puedas seguir el flujo del taller sin ningún problema.


Los requisitos para poder ver éste curso son:

  • Tener conocimiento básico de programación.

  • Conocimientos sobre programación orientado a objetos.

  • Conocimiento básico de Laravel.

  • Conocimiento básico de Livewire.


Éste curso va dirigido a aquellas personas que desean profundizar en los fundamentos de Livewire y aprender nuevas funcionalidades, a la vez que se construye un proyecto completo.


Nota 1: Si no tienes conocimientos básicos de Livewire, te recomiendo mi curso básico sobre el mismo, el cuál lo encontrarás en mi perfil de Udemy, es totalmente gratis.


Nota 2: Este curso fue grabado con Laravel 9.x y Livewire 2.x. Si al momento de ver este curso existen nuevas versiones queda a tu elección si usarlas o utilizar las mismas versiones que el instructor.

Screenshots

Laravel Livewire y TDD: Crea un Portafolio Dinámico - Screenshot_01Laravel Livewire y TDD: Crea un Portafolio Dinámico - Screenshot_02Laravel Livewire y TDD: Crea un Portafolio Dinámico - Screenshot_03Laravel Livewire y TDD: Crea un Portafolio Dinámico - Screenshot_04

Reviews

Kevin
October 8, 2023
Excelente curso. Lo unico que tengo para decir es que a veces sentía que explicaba demasiado, pero precisamente eso hace ver que eres un gran profesor porque te tomas tu tiempo para explicar a lujo de detalle lo que le viene super genial sobre todo a los principiantes. Te felicito y que Dios te bendiga.
Martin
January 24, 2023
Un maravilloso curso con un lindo proyecto, lo unico malo (que realmente no creo que le haga bajar de puntaje) son los commits en el repositorio. ¿Por qué? - Simplemente hay commits donde hace 2 clases en un solo commit. lo que hace perderse en lo que se hace en el momento.
Cristina
December 27, 2022
El curso cumple perfectamente lo propuesto y Gustavo es profesor excelente, que explica con calma y profundidad cada paso que se da. Es imposible perderse. Gracias!

Charts

Price

Laravel Livewire y TDD: Crea un Portafolio Dinámico - Price chart

Rating

Laravel Livewire y TDD: Crea un Portafolio Dinámico - Ratings chart

Enrollment distribution

Laravel Livewire y TDD: Crea un Portafolio Dinámico - Distribution chart
4908708
udemy ID
10/1/2022
course created date
10/27/2022
course indexed date
Bot
course submited by